About Continental General: The Continental General family of companies has provided insurance, including life and long-term care policies, to individuals and groups for over 30 years, and currently supports over 200,000 policyholders. Both our insurance company, Continental General Insurance Company, and our third-party administrator, Continental General Services, are committed to the continuous development of our infrastructure, processes, and people. The group is actively growing through expansion of both its insurance portfolio and its administrative services. Position Overview: The AI Solutions Engineering Manager owns multiple delivery teams or a complex domain area within a value stream vertical. Where the M1 Supervisor owns a single team's delivery, the M2 Manager is accountable for the coordination, performance, and strategic direction of multiple domain teams. You are responsible for ensuring your teams collectively deliver on value stream objectives while maintaining the small-team, AI-native delivery model. You balance organizational scale with the intimacy and empowerment that makes small teams effective. You are a key voice in shaping the organization's AI delivery strategy and talent development pipeline.
